## Runbook: Account Recovery for the Quellhorn Autoscaler

The Quellhorn autoscaler scales workers off queue depth in the Bramblewick broker. If its service account is locked out, scaling freezes and queues back up within minutes, so treat recovery as urgent. First confirm the lockout in the Ferrel admin panel, then open the recovery flow for the quellhorn-svc account. Do not reset credentials manually; that desyncs the scaler's token cache. The recovery flow will prompt you for the passphrase shown below.

recovery phrase for bawif-yawif: gorwyn-kelix-zorox-silath-novix-juleth

## Support

Reviewing Lanternshift's zero-downtime migration tooling? A few pointers. All migrations follow the expand-contract pattern, so there's never a window where old and new code disagree on the schema — the audit log in Ledgerpine records every phase transition if you want to verify. Rollbacks are forward-only by design; we document why in the security notes. If something looks off, or you want a walkthrough of how we gate destructive changes behind the two-person approval flow, just ask. The migrations team is happy to chat.

escalation mailbox, bafog-fafog: ulador@paliqlabs.internal

Team — quick note before the quarterly DR drill. We'll fail over the Givewell-style receipt mailer, Thankletter, to the Oakmere standby region and replay Tuesday's queue. Reviewers: please sanity-check the template renderer diff first. To bring the standby mailer out of read-only mode during the drill, enter the recovery passphrase below.

recovery phrase for fajep-yaweg: gilath-sorox-wenius-rusdor-keliel-zorius